Thursday, August 5, 2010. Right now, almost a billion people on the planet don’t have access to clean, safe drinking water. That’s one in eight of us. 4,500 children will die today due to water related diseases. And, every 19 seconds, a child dies from unsafe water and lack of basic sanitation facilities.
